Commercial Slab Construction in Marietta, GA
Commercial slab construction services involve the creation of solid, level concrete foundations that support a variety of large-scale projects. This service is typically used for building parking lots, warehouse floors, retail spaces, and industrial facilities. Property owners should understand that these slabs are designed to provide a durable and stable base for ongoing construction or operational needs, often requiring careful site preparation, precise leveling, and proper reinforcement to ensure longevity and performance.
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ners usually want to know about the scope of the project, including size and load requirements, as well as any specific site conditions that might affect installation. It is also important to consider factors such as drainage, access for heavy equipment, and future expansion plans. Clear communication about these details helps ensure the foundation meets the intended use and provides a reliable base for the structure or equipment that will be built upon it.

Commercial Slab Construction Questions
What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are typically used for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and outdoor storage areas on commercial properties.
What materials are commonly used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the most common material, often reinforced with steel to enhance strength and durability for heavy use.
How thick should a commercial slab be? The thickness depends on the intended use, but generally ranges from 4 to 8 inches for most commercial applications.
What factors influence the preparation of a commercial slab? Proper site grading, soil compaction, and the installation of a suitable base are essential for a stable and long-lasting slab.
